October 21, 2015 9:27 AM EDTSynta Pharmaceuticals Corp. (NASDAQ: SNTA) 66.7% LOWER; announced that the Company has decided to terminate the Phase 3 GALAXY-2 trial of ganetespib and docetaxel in the second-line treatment of patients with advanced non-small cell lung adenocarcinoma. Based on the review of a pre-planned interim analysis, the studys Independent Data Monitoring Committee (IDMC) concluded that the addition of ganetespib to docetaxel is unlikely to demonstrate a statistically significant improvement in the primary endpoint... Intuitive Surgical (ISRG) 'Outperform' Reiterated, PT Trimmed to $593 at Leerink Partners
October 21, 2015 9:00 AM EDTLeerink Partners analyst Richard Newitter reiterated an Outperform rating on Intuitive Surgical (NASDAQ: ISRG) following solid Q3 results but trimmed his price target to $593.00 (from $600.00).
Newitter commented, "ISRG's 3Q saw above-expectations system rev, procedure growth, and GM. The outperformance (plus upped procedure & GM... More
Intuitive Surgical (ISRG) PT Lifted to $565 at Evercore ISI Amid Strong Q3
October 21, 2015 8:11 AM EDTEvercore ISI analyst Vijay Kumar reiterated a Buy rating and raised his price target on Intuitive Surgical (NASDAQ: ISRG) to $565.00 (from $545.00) following strong Q3 results.
Kumar commented, "3Q was a déjà vu of 2Q, highlighted by a STRONG procedure growth and decent systems placements, with the caveat being an even more impressive margin pull through. This was one of the most complete quarters that ISRG has put up... More

Intuitive Surgical (ISRG) Tops Q3 EPS by 101c
October 20, 2015 4:09 PM EDTIntuitive Surgical (NASDAQ: ISRG) reported Q3 EPS of $5.24, $1.01 better than the analyst estimate of $4.23. Revenue for the quarter came in at $590 million versus the consensus estimate of $580.37 million.

October 20, 2015 7:13 AM EDTBy Caroline Valetkevitch
(Reuters) - U.S. stocks ended slightly lower on Tuesday as a decline in healthcare and biotech stocks offset gains in United Technologies and Verizon.
A 5.7 percent drop to $140.64 in IBM (NYSE: IBM) also weighed on the market. The stock hit a five-year intraday low at $140.28 after it reported a bigger-than-expected decline in quarterly revenue and cut its full-year profit forecast.
The S&P healthcare sector fell 1.5 percent, while the Nasdaq Biotech Index dropped 3.2 percent. Concerns about drug pricing have hit biotech and other healthcare shares.
